Transaction ff95d640f2ab55ff50a1fea65a0cf72c89370c7be4e281c5f2667583cfa7c3cd

145 Input
2 Outputs
  • ff95d640f2ab55ff50a1fea65a0cf72c89370c7be4e281c5f2667583cfa7c3cd:0
  • value  3100000000
    address  19pFnhxBwvkGZmsbLYRr4z796A8owoYVDG
  • ff95d640f2ab55ff50a1fea65a0cf72c89370c7be4e281c5f2667583cfa7c3cd:1
  • value  2015213
    address  1C8aJ8sjbLBwS69Ljuw7pJcRzaoZipSuAo